This engraving by Leonard Schenk, titled *Proclamatie van Peter II Aleksejevitsj tot tsaar van Rusland*, depicts the proclamation of Peter II as Tsar of Russia in 1727. The scene takes place in a public square, where Peter II is shown on horseback, surrounded by a crowd of people. In the background, a man on a balcony reads the proclamation. The engraving captures a moment of important historical significance, as it commemorates the ascension of a young ruler to the Russian throne. Schenk's detailed rendering of the scene, along with the accompanying text in Dutch, offers a glimpse into the events of the time. This etching is a significant piece of historical art as well as a representation of 18th-century Dutch engraving.
